Transaction 8af30a70fce6643c80c7210196e8b3f0f6b99d05dc7318ede27ddb3f02fa106e
1 Input
1 Output
-
8af30a70fce6643c80c7210196e8b3f0f6b99d05dc7318ede27ddb3f02fa106e:0
- value
- 2163233
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 14a234416d4458edc1606087ae4171c84841fea9 OP_EQUAL
- address
- 33a7kX8yrKFFZWBonScq32eGZ3fMxvDtnh